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ee for Malaysia

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ee Template for Malaysia

A Former Employee Reference Letter is a formal document issued under Malaysian employment law that provides verification of past employment and potentially includes performance assessment. The document serves as an official confirmation of an individual's previous employment relationship, typically detailing the duration of employment, position held, and general conduct. In Malaysia, these letters must comply with the Personal Data Protection Act 2010 and avoid any potentially defamatory content as per the Defamation Act 1957. The letter should be factual, objective, and provide a fair representation of the former employee's service while maintaining professional standards and legal compliance.

What is a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ee?

The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ee is a crucial document in the Malaysian employment landscape, commonly requested when individuals seek new employment opportunities or require proof of their work history. This document serves multiple purposes: it verifies previous employment, provides information about job responsibilities, and may include performance assessments when authorized. Under Malaysian law, particularly considering the Personal Data Protection Act 2010 and Employment Act 1955, these letters must be handled with appropriate care regarding personal data and factual accuracy. The document is typically issued upon the completion of employment or upon request from a former employee, and may be required for various purposes including job applications, visa processes, or educational applications. The content and format should be professional, accurate, and balanced, avoiding any potentially discriminatory or defamatory statements while providing useful information for the intended recipient.

What sections should be included in a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ee?

1. Letter Header: Company letterhead, date, and reference number if applicable

2. Addressee Details: The 'To Whom It May Concern' statement or specific recipient details

3. Employee Identification: Full name, last position held, and employee ID if applicable

4. Employment Period: Start and end dates of employment

5. Position Description: Brief overview of role and responsibilities

6. Confirmation of Employment: Statement confirming the employment relationship

7. Professional Conduct: Brief statement about the employee's general conduct and reliability

8. Closing Statement: Standard closing and contact information for further queries

9. Signature Block: Name, position, and signature of the authorized person writing the reference

What sections are optional to include in a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ee?

1. Reason for Leaving: Include only if requested and if the departure was amicable

2. Performance Assessment: Specific details about performance, achievements, and skills - include if specifically requested

3. Salary Information: Last drawn salary and benefits - include only if authorized by the former employee

4. Project Highlights: Specific projects or achievements - include for senior positions or when specifically relevant

5. Training Completed: List of relevant training and certifications obtained during employment - include for technical or specialized roles

What schedules should be included in a Former Employee Reference Letter For Employee?

1. Performance History Summary: Detailed breakdown of performance reviews if requested and relevant

2. Project Portfolio: List of major projects and responsibilities, particularly for technical or senior roles

3. Training Certificates: Copies of relevant training certificates obtained during employment

4. Awards and Recognition: List of awards, recognition, or special achievements during employment period
